Market Overview

Mexico Automotive Air Filter market size was valued at USD 115.448 million in 2024 and is anticipated to reach USD 166.479 million by 2032, at a CAGR of 4.68% during the forecast period (2024-2032).

The Mexico automotive air filter market is driven by increasing vehicle production and sales, stringent emission regulations, and rising awareness of air quality and engine efficiency. Growing urbanization and industrialization have heightened concerns about air pollution, boosting the demand for advanced air filtration solutions. The expansion of the automotive aftermarket, coupled with increasing vehicle maintenance and replacement cycles, further supports market growth. Technological advancements, such as nanofiber and HEPA filters, are gaining traction due to their superior filtration efficiency. Additionally, the rising adoption of electric and hybrid vehicles presents opportunities for specialized air filters tailored to battery cooling systems. The shift towards eco-friendly and reusable filters aligns with sustainability trends, encouraging manufacturers to innovate. Furthermore, the presence of key automotive manufacturers and suppliers in Mexico strengthens the supply chain, enhancing market accessibility. Overall, regulatory support, consumer demand for high-performance vehicles, and continuous product advancements are shaping the market’s trajectory.

The Mexico automotive air filter market is shaped by regional automotive hubs, urban pollution levels, and industrial growth, with key demand centers in Mexico City, Monterrey, Guadalajara, and Tijuana. These regions drive market expansion through high vehicle ownership, aftermarket sales, and stringent emission regulations. Increasing air pollution concerns further boost the adoption of advanced filtration technologies, particularly in urban areas. The market is highly competitive, with key players such as Mann+Hummel Group, Donaldson Company, Inc., K&N Engineering, Inc., Fram Group, Cummins Inc., ACDelco, WIX Filters, Parker Hannifin Corporation, Baldwin Filters, and Hastings Premium Filters dominating the industry. These companies focus on product innovation, expanding their distribution networks, and adopting eco-friendly materials to enhance efficiency and sustainability. Growing consumer awareness and government regulations supporting air quality improvements create a favorable environment for market growth, encouraging manufacturers to invest in high-performance filtration solutions tailored to the Mexican automotive industry.

Market Drivers

Rising Vehicle Production and Expanding Automotive Industry

The growth of the automotive industry in Mexico plays a crucial role in driving the demand for automotive air filters. As one of the largest automobile manufacturing hubs in North America, Mexico hosts major automakers and suppliers, leading to increased vehicle production. For instance, the Mexican Automotive Industry Association (AMIA) reported a significant increase in vehicle production, reaching record highs in recent years, which underscores the industry’s robust growth and its impact on the demand for automotive components like air filters. The expansion of domestic and international automotive manufacturers, coupled with favorable government policies and trade agreements, has bolstered the industry. This surge in production necessitates the use of high-quality air filters to enhance engine performance and reduce emissions. Additionally, the rising sales of passenger and commercial vehicles, driven by improving economic conditions and increasing disposable income, further propel market demand. The robust presence of Original Equipment Manufacturers (OEMs) and a well-established supply chain facilitate seamless distribution, ensuring market growth.

Stringent Emission Regulations and Environmental Concerns

Mexico’s strict emission regulations and growing environmental concerns significantly contribute to the increasing adoption of automotive air filters. Regulatory bodies such as the Secretaría de Medio Ambiente y Recursos Naturales (SEMARNAT) have implemented stringent guidelines to control vehicular emissions and air pollution. For example, the NOM-044-SEMARNAT-2017 regulation sets standards for heavy-duty vehicles, mandating the use of efficient air filtration systems to minimize harmful emissions and improve air quality. Additionally, global environmental initiatives and commitments to reduce carbon footprints have encouraged automakers to integrate advanced air filters into their vehicles. Consumers are also becoming more aware of the adverse effects of air pollution on health and vehicle performance, prompting higher demand for superior filtration solutions. As regulatory frameworks evolve, manufacturers are investing in research and development to create innovative air filter technologies that comply with emission norms while enhancing engine efficiency.

Growing Aftermarket Demand and Vehicle Maintenance Trends

The expanding automotive aftermarket in Mexico is another key driver of the automotive air filter market. As vehicle ownership rises, so does the demand for regular maintenance and replacement of essential components, including air filters. Frequent replacement is necessary to ensure optimal engine performance, fuel efficiency, and reduced emissions, further boosting market growth. Independent workshops, service centers, and online platforms contribute to the accessibility of aftermarket air filters, enabling consumers to choose from a wide range of options. Additionally, increasing consumer awareness regarding preventive maintenance and vehicle longevity has driven demand for high-performance and durable air filters. The rise in do-it-yourself (DIY) vehicle maintenance trends also supports aftermarket sales, as more consumers prefer cost-effective and easily replaceable air filter solutions.

Advancements in Air Filter Technology and Sustainability Initiatives

Technological advancements in air filtration systems are reshaping the Mexico automotive air filter market. The development of high-efficiency particulate air (HEPA) filters, nanofiber technology, and activated carbon filters has significantly improved filtration performance, catering to evolving consumer needs. These innovations enhance engine longevity, improve fuel efficiency, and contribute to better air quality inside vehicles. Furthermore, the rising emphasis on sustainability has encouraged manufacturers to develop eco-friendly air filters, such as reusable and biodegradable variants. The growing trend of electric and hybrid vehicles has also created demand for specialized air filters designed for battery cooling and cabin air purification. As automakers and filter manufacturers invest in research and innovation, the market is witnessing the introduction of advanced, cost-effective, and environmentally friendly solutions, driving long-term growth.

Market Challenges Analysis

Price Sensitivity and Competition from Low-Cost Alternatives

The Mexico automotive air filter market faces significant challenges due to price sensitivity among consumers and intense competition from low-cost alternatives. Many vehicle owners prioritize affordability when selecting replacement air filters, often opting for cheaper, lower-quality products that may not provide optimal filtration efficiency. For instance, the Mexican government’s efforts to enhance consumer awareness about the importance of using genuine automotive parts, including air filters, have highlighted the risks associated with counterfeit products, which can compromise vehicle performance and safety. This trend poses a challenge for premium air filter manufacturers that focus on high-performance and technologically advanced solutions. Additionally, the presence of counterfeit and substandard products in the market further intensifies competition, as these alternatives often compromise vehicle performance and engine longevity. To counter this challenge, established brands must emphasize product differentiation, offer competitive pricing strategies, and educate consumers about the long-term benefits of investing in high-quality air filtration systems.

Supply Chain Disruptions and Fluctuating Raw Material Costs

Supply chain disruptions and fluctuating raw material costs present another significant challenge for the Mexico automotive air filter market. The industry relies on a steady supply of materials such as synthetic fibers, activated carbon, and paper-based filtration media, which are susceptible to price volatility and global supply chain constraints. Disruptions in raw material procurement, transportation delays, and geopolitical uncertainties can lead to increased production costs and supply shortages. These factors directly impact the pricing and availability of air filters in the market, making it difficult for manufacturers to maintain consistent profit margins. Additionally, stringent trade policies and import-export regulations can further complicate the supply chain, affecting product distribution across different regions in Mexico. To mitigate these risks, manufacturers must adopt robust supply chain management strategies, explore local sourcing options, and invest in sustainable materials that offer long-term cost stability.

Market Segmentation Analysis:

By Type:

The Mexico automotive air filter market is segmented into cabin air filters and engine air filters, each serving distinct functions in vehicle performance and air quality management. Cabin air filters are gaining significant traction due to increasing consumer awareness of in-cabin air quality and rising pollution levels in urban areas. These filters effectively remove dust, allergens, and pollutants, enhancing passenger comfort and health. The growing adoption of high-efficiency particulate air (HEPA) and activated carbon filters further supports demand, particularly in premium and electric vehicles. On the other hand, engine air filters play a critical role in protecting the engine from contaminants such as dust, debris, and pollen, ensuring efficient combustion and prolonged engine life. The rising vehicle production in Mexico, coupled with stringent emission regulations, is fueling demand for advanced engine air filters with superior filtration capabilities. As both segments experience technological advancements and increased aftermarket sales, manufacturers are focusing on developing durable, high-performance air filters that cater to evolving consumer and regulatory requirements.

By Material:

The market is further segmented based on material type, including paper, foam, and synthetic air filters, each offering unique advantages in terms of filtration efficiency and durability. Paper air filters dominate the market due to their affordability, widespread availability, and effective filtration properties. These filters are commonly used in both cabin and engine applications, making them a preferred choice for mass-market vehicles. Foam air filters, known for their reusability and enhanced airflow capabilities, are popular among performance-oriented vehicles and off-road applications. They provide superior dust-holding capacity and are often used in extreme conditions where higher filtration efficiency is required. Synthetic air filters, including those made from nanofiber and non-woven materials, are gaining momentum due to their durability, extended lifespan, and superior filtration performance. These filters are increasingly preferred in high-end vehicles and electric models, where advanced filtration technology is essential. As demand for sustainable and high-performance filtration solutions rises, manufacturers are investing in material innovations to enhance efficiency and environmental sustainability.

Regional Analysis

Mexico City

Mexico City holds the largest market share at approximately 35%, driven by its extensive vehicle fleet, high pollution levels, and strict emission regulations. The city experiences high pollution levels, leading to increased demand for advanced air filtration solutions, particularly in passenger vehicles. The implementation of strict emission control measures by local authorities has accelerated the adoption of high-efficiency cabin and engine air filters. Consumers in Mexico City are also becoming more conscious of in-cabin air quality, further boosting demand for premium cabin air filters with HEPA and activated carbon technology. Additionally, the growing trend of vehicle maintenance and aftermarket sales in the metropolitan area supports the replacement air filter market. As environmental concerns persist, manufacturers are focusing on innovative solutions to meet regulatory and consumer expectations, sustaining market growth in the region.

Monterrey

Monterrey follows with a 25% market share, benefiting from its strong automotive manufacturing sector and rising demand for high-performance vehicle components. The city is home to several global automakers, suppliers, and industrial hubs, fueling demand for high-quality air filters in both OEM and aftermarket segments. The presence of manufacturing plants for commercial and passenger vehicles drives the need for efficient engine air filters that enhance performance and fuel efficiency. Additionally, Monterrey’s industrial emissions contribute to air quality concerns, increasing the demand for cabin air filters. The region’s strong economic growth and rising disposable income levels further encourage consumers to invest in premium vehicle components. As the automotive sector continues to expand, the demand for durable and technologically advanced air filters is expected to rise, making Monterrey a crucial market for industry players.

Guadalajara and Tijuana

Guadalajara accounts for around 20% of the market, supported by increasing vehicle ownership and a growing aftermarket segment. The increasing number of passenger vehicles, combined with a strong presence of service centers and repair shops, supports demand for replacement filters. The city’s climate and air pollution levels also contribute to the rising adoption of cabin air filters, especially in urban areas. Tijuana holds a 15% market share, driven by cross-border trade, industrial growth, and a rising preference for advanced filtration systems. The region’s cross-border trade and industrial growth contribute to the demand for advanced air filtration systems, particularly in commercial and heavy-duty vehicles. As economic activities in both cities continue to expand, the automotive air filter market in these regions is expected to witness steady growth, supported by increasing consumer awareness and aftermarket opportunities.

Recent Developments

  • In January 2025, Donaldson Company, Inc. partnered with Daimler Truck North America to feature its advanced air filter technology in the Freightliner SuperTruck III, a hydrogen fuel cell truck project.
  • In January 2025, Freudenberg Filtration Technologies introduced the “micronAir Gas Shield” line, a premium activated carbon selection for automotive cabin air filters, offering regionally customized options to adsorb harmful gases and odors.
  • In July 2024, Mann+Hummel launched nanofiber-based cabin air filters, known as Mann-Filter FreciousPlus, which effectively filter ultra-fine particles and pollutants.
  • In January 2024, Robert Bosch GmbH replaced the FILTER+ cabin air filter with the enhanced FILTER+pro, offering improved filtration performance and reduced germ transmission.
